Sleepless nights thinking about parting with my 2014 C63 white sedan





Well - excuse me while I utilize the board as a little bit of therapy as I debate a big decision


When I began the search for the car I really wanted, optioned how I wanted, it was long and tough, but I finally tracked it down on the show room floor of a neighboring state dealer.
December 2014 I found her, clean and out of the elements on the showroom floor, polar white with black interior, and all the best options I wanted:
2014 C63 AMG sedan
-polar white
-black mb tex / dinamica
-aluminum trim
-AMG performance media, an AWESOME option I rarely if ever see
-rear side airbags
-limited slip differential, a MUST
-keyess go
-lighting package
-multimedia package


I bought it, and drove it right to the car storage facility I utilize, not to be seen again until April 2015.


I had big plans for the car, car shows, AMG gatherings, maybe a HPDE track day or two, but the reality hit, I just didn't have the time to do any of these things I envisioned for the car. It ultimately turned into a great car to take out 1-3 days a week solo or with my family and just enjoy it.


And enjoy it I did as I tastefully modded it right away that summer of '15, got thumbs up and people gathered around it asking questions a lot when I was out with it.


Babied it I did, factory tires on factory wheels have almost all tread left as they were only on car a few days, because right when I bought the car, I started the process on the 3 month lead time for custom built Velos Designwerks wheels, heck the Pilot Super Sport tires on them have seen 2 summers, and have 1 more of life left at least!
Cars paint has never been touched by a towel, I air dried only with my air blower. Car sits with under 12,900 miles on it currently in storage since October.


I was planning to keep the car for many, many years, and wanted to pamper it as much as possible.........then it happened, an evil mistress popped into my dreams, her name 2017 C63s Coupe. In short, it displays on the media screen, has its own separate button that says "AMG" on it, to activate it, by seat heater buttons.
You can change the screen to display digital gauges of engine/transmission temperature vitals, record track performance, load different tracks if you are there, measure cornering and acceleration G's, 0-60, 1/4 mile.....display the individual tires pressures, etc,etc

Its an awesome feature I almost never see anywhere else, It was a $2,500 option on the 2014 C63.
